Generally speaking, the basic concept of attractor point is to assign the relationship between objects and certain points, which is called attractor points, to parameters of the geometric manipulations to objects. for example, following image shows the most typical way to use attractor point. Definition: an attractor is a specific point or set of points in the design space that influences the geometry around it. the attractor “attracts” or “repels” other points or objects based.
